Oppenheimer Holdings Revises its Third Quarter 2011 Earnings Announcement
Oppenheimer Holdings (NYSE: OPY) is reporting a revision to its third quarter 2011 earnings announcement dated October 28, 2011. Revisions in the current period affect only the reported amounts for total stockholders' equity, book value per share and tangible book value per share at September 30, 2011. There is no change to reported earnings in the current period.
The revisions described above have no impact on the Company's net cash amounts provided by (used in) operating, financing or investing activities for any previously reported periods, nor the current period.
Subsequent to the filing of its earnings announcement, the Company identified historical errors relating to its tax treatment of deferred compensation obligations assumed as part of a 2003 acquisition. As a result, the Company has determined the need to reestablish book basis of goodwill related to the 2003 transaction in the amount of $5.4 million. Further, the Company has established a reserve for uncertain tax positions in the amount of $3 million, including accrued interest, as well as cumulative adjustments to current and deferred tax items of $6.6 million primarily related to periods prior to 2008. In conjunction with the revision described above, the Company has also revised its consolidated financial statements for previously disclosed immaterial out-of-period adjustments. The Company has revised its prior period consolidated financial statements by adjusting opening retained earnings as of January 1, 2010 in the amount of $7.5 million.
For a full discussion of these matters, you are directed to the Company's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the quarterly period ended September 30, 2011, which is being fil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ission today.
